Jonathan Bennett is a mathematician and Professor of Mathematical Analysis at the University of Birmingham. He was a recipient of the Whitehead Prize of the London Mathematical Society in 2011 for "his foundational work on multilinear inequalities in harmonic and geometric analysis, and for a number of major results in the theory of oscillatory integrals."[1]

He earned his B.A. in Mathematics from Hertford College of the University of Oxford in 1995 and Ph.D. in Harmonic Analysis from the University of Edinburgh in 1999. He did his postdoctoral work at Edinburgh University, the Universidad Autonoma de Madrid and Trinity College Dublin. He joined Birmingham University in 2005.[2]
